Opposes any federal taxpayer funding for abortion providers; his platform explicitly rejects channeling public funds to Planned Parenthood or any abortion-industry entity.
Buckner's entire campaign is built around 'Audit the Senate' — exposing and reducing congressional waste. His platform calls for cutting federal regulations that inflate production costs, champions domestic natural-gas manufacturing over costly imports, and takes zero PAC money or billionaire funding to avoid captured-spending incentives — a limited-government, anti-waste posture consistent with the rubric's anti-deficit and balanced-budget standard.
Buckner's campaign (auditthesenate.com) explicitly opposes mass mail-in voting expansion and runs under the 'Audit the Senate' brand — a government-accountability platform built around election process transparency. He spent years documenting government meetings on camera and accepts zero PAC money or special-interest backing, positioning himself as a safeguard against institutional fraud in elections and government alike.
Supports fully funding and completing the southern border wall, designating Mexican drug cartels as Foreign Terrorist Organizations, and treating cartel fentanyl networks as a direct act of war against Americans.
Opposes federal red flag laws, universal background checks, and magazine restrictions; pledges to 'defend the Second Amendment' and recruit arms and ammunition manufacturers to Oklahoma.
